Etymology: From the Latin rupis, rock, and –cola, cultivation, referring to the rocky habitats where this species grows. Selected additional references: Wheeler [(1996a) taxonomic notes, key]. Notes: A remarkable species among all the representatives of Carex subgenus Vignea, found in dry rocky soils growing with cacti, a quite unusual habitat for a Carex species. As a notable vegetative character, sterile shoots are strongly thickened at the base forming a corm.
